NCERT Solutions For Class 10 Science Chapter 4: Carbon and Its Compounds
Carbon is a versatile element that serves as the foundation for all living beings. It is tetravalent and has the catenation property. By sharing electrons between two atoms, carbon forms covalent bonds and achieves a filled outermost shell. With oxygen, chlorine, hydrogen, nitrogen, sulphur, and itself, it forms covalent bonds. It can produce compounds with double and triple bonds. Carbon chains are divided into three types: branching, ring, and straight. Carbon is a significant source of energy. Ethanoic acid and ethanol are carbon molecules that are vital to our daily life. The hydrophilic and hydrophobic groups in detergents and soaps aid in the emulsification and removal of oily dirt.

List the concepts covered in NCERT Solutions of Science Chapter 4 for Class 10.
Answer: The following are the topics covered in Chapter 4 of NCERT Solutions for Class 10 Science:-
- Bonding in Carbon – The covalent bond
- Versatile nature of carbon
- Chemical properties of carbon compounds
- Some important carbon compounds – ethanol and ethanoic acid
- Soaps and detergents
